Course Content

• Wildland Fire Behavior and Prediction
• Forest Fire Risk Assessment and Mapping (GIS)
• Forest Fire Prevention and Mitigation Strategies
• Fire Suppression Techniques and Tactics
• Post-Fire Rehabilitation and Ecosystem Restoration
• Forest Fire Emergency Response and Management
• Climate Change and Wildfire Risk
• Community Wildfire Protection Planning
• Legal and Regulatory Frameworks for Forest Fire Management

Career path

Career Role (Forest Fire Risk Management) Description
Forest Fire Prevention Officer Develops and implements prevention strategies; conducts risk assessments; liaises with communities.
Wildfire Risk Management Specialist Analyzes fire risk, develops mitigation plans, and monitors fire behavior; expert in risk assessment and mitigation.
Forest Fire Suppression Technician Responds to wildfires; operates firefighting equipment; collaborates with teams for wildfire suppression.
Environmental Consultant (Forest Fire) Advises on sustainable forest management; conducts environmental impact assessments related to fire risk.
